


Brazil Agenito de Oliveria Luz Microlot
Region: Chapada Diamantina, Brazil
Varietal: Catuai
Altitude: 1100m
Processing: Dry-processed using solar dryers
Roast: Light
Notes: Smooth body, bright acidity, brown sugar, marzipan
Brazil is known for its large scale coffee production, but not all farms are alike! The Farinha Seca farm was founded when Agenito managed to buy 1.5 hectares of land after much struggle. At first the area was dominated by grasses. Over time the producer took care of that space, preparing it for future coffee planting. As soon as his plantation was established, Agenito married and his companion helps him run the farm with great dedication. Thanks to this care the results of the crop are great and are being recognized in the quality contests in Brazil. |
